Have you ever encountered a problem where your PC refused to connect to your phone via USB cable? It could be old Windows, or the drivers don't fit, the cable is damaged, or worst of all, the phone socket is damaged. This is when the built-in File Manager FTP server feature comes in handy. If your phone and your computer are on the same Wi-Fi router and network, you can turn your phone into an FTP server and, for example. Total Commander or other FTP client software to connect and access the entire internal storage of your phone!

  • Open the File Manager application
  • Select the Categories tab from the top menu
  • Tap on the green FTP icon
  • To configure the server, tap the Setup button below

  • Keep the screen awake: do not turn off the phone screen while the FTP server is running
  • Transmission encoding: decoding of file character set between server and client, set to UTF-8, this is best for us, as we are not using Chinese
  • Secure FTP transfer: you can specify the FTP port, most servers use the standard port 21, our phone defaults to 2121, keep it that way. By enabling anonymous FTP in the client, set up an Anonymous connection where you only need to set an email address. If you are at home, leave it as it is. If you are on an open or other network, turn this on and under the User name and password menu, enter a User name and a password that the client can use to connect to your phone.

Go back and click on the Start Server button. To stop the server, just click Stop Server.

Sometimes it's a better way to access files because it's faster than some USB connections and if you have a lot of files, you can access them faster.
